Transaction 56e70ff1949efabae332a6fca5b91e895637ae9089b841d41091c9f50d679a59
1 Input
2 Outputs
- 56e70ff1949efabae332a6fca5b91e895637ae9089b841d41091c9f50d679a59:0
- 56e70ff1949efabae332a6fca5b91e895637ae9089b841d41091c9f50d679a59:1
value 141585
address 12yMSQKcPfbdtxRPDP5PQ8B7wmTkzB6Htk
value 46593891
address 1CfBKsZopLMM4X1oJoLw6sEZPkctHg8AG8